SMALL BUSINESS ADMINISTRATION

[Disaster Declaration #14970 and #14971]


North Carolina Disaster #NC-00086

AGENCY: U.S. Small Business Administration.

ACTION: Notice.

-----------------------------------------------------------------------

SUMMARY: This is a Notice of the Presidential declaration of a major 
disaster for Public Assistance Only for the State of North Carolina 
(FEMA-4285-DR), dated 11/10/2016.

[[Page 81857]]

    Incident: Hurricane Matthew.
    Incident Period: 10/04/2016 and continuing.
    Effective Date: 11/10/2016.
    Physical Loan Application Deadline Date: 01/09/2017.
    Economic Injury (EIDL) Loan Application Deadline Date: 08/10/2017.

ADDRESSES: Submit completed loan applications to: U.S. Small Business 
Administration, Processing and Disbursement Center, 14925 Kingsport 
Road, Fort Worth, TX 76155.

FOR FURTHER INFORMATION CONTACT: A. Escobar, Office of Disaster 
Assistance, U.S. Small Business Administration, 409 3rd Street SW., 
Suite 6050, Washington, DC 20416.

SUPPLEMENTARY INFORMATION: Notice is hereby given that as a result of 
the President's major disaster declaration on 11/10/2016, Private Non-
Profit organizations that provide essential services of governmental 
nature may file disaster loan applications at the address listed above 
or other locally announced locations.
    The following areas have been determined to be adversely affected 
by the disaster:

Primary Counties: Anson Bladen Chatham Cumberland Franklin Halifax Hoke 
Johnston Lee Nash Richmond Scotland Wake

    The Interest Rates are:

------------------------------------------------------------------------
                                                                Percent
------------------------------------------------------------------------
For Physical Damage:
  Non-Profit Organizations With Credit Available Elsewhere...      2.625
  Non-Profit Organizations Without Credit Available Elsewhere      2.625
For Economic Injury:
  Non-Profit Organizations Without Credit Available Elsewhere      2.625
------------------------------------------------------------------------

    The number assigned to this disaster for physical damage is 149708 
and for economic injury is 149718.

(Catalog of Federal Domestic Assistance Number 59008)

James E. Rivera,
Associate Administrator for Disaster Assistance.
